The Job of Dental Hygienists<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"PleasantWhen comparing the job of a dental hygienist to that of an assistant, the most significant difference is undoubtedly that the hygienist works more independently. Dental assistants work with and assists the Pleasant Hill MO dentists and the practice. Hygienists, while also assisting the practice, deal with the patients more on an individual basis. They are often the first person a patient encounters when called from the waiting area. They examine each patient’s gums and teeth and present their findings to the dentists.
